Johnson County, Wyoming Historical Nativity Trends (2010–2024)

Johnson County, Wyoming Population & Nativity History
| Year | Total Pop | Foreign Born | Native Born |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 8,686 | 2.5% | 97.5% |
| 2023 | 8,602 | 2.0% | 98.0% |
| 2022 | 8,536 | 2.7% | 97.3% |
| 2021 | 8,457 | 1.5% | 98.5% |
| 2020 | 8,518 | 1.2% | 98.8% |
| 2019 | 8,487 | 1.1% | 98.9% |
| 2018 | 8,515 | 1.2% | 98.8% |
| 2017 | 8,562 | 2.4% | 97.6% |
| 2016 | 8,572 | 1.7% | 98.3% |
| 2015 | 8,600 | 1.1% | 98.9% |
| 2014 | 8,599 | 2.4% | 97.6% |
| 2013 | 8,595 | 1.8% | 98.2% |
| 2012 | 8,564 | 2.2% | 97.8% |
| 2011 | 8,478 | 2.1% | 97.9% |
| 2010 | 8,307 | 2.1% | 97.9% |
Nativity & Citizenship FAQs for Johnson County, Wyoming
Approximately 2.5% of residents in Johnson County, Wyoming were born outside the United States.
The vast majority of residents, roughly 98.6%, are U.S. citizens (including both native-born and naturalized citizens).
